Discovering the Prosperous Flavors of Peranakan Cuisine: Mee Siam, Ayam Buah Keluak, and the most effective Nyonya Food in Singapore

Singapore is renowned for its numerous culinary heritage, and One of the more treasured meals cultures is Peranakan Delicacies, typically called Nyonya food. A fusion of Chinese, Malay, and Indonesian influences, Peranakan foodstuff is known for its abundant, Daring flavors, and complicated preparing strategies. Some legendary dishes On this vivid Delicacies contain Mee Siam, Ayam Buah Keluak, and a variety of other Nyonya specialties. one. Mee Siam Paste: The guts of the Tangy, Spicy Dish
Mee Siam is Probably the most beloved Peranakan dishes, recognized for its exclusive mixture of sweet, tangy, and spicy flavors. At the center of the dish will be the Mee Siam paste, a abundant mixture of ingredients that provides the dish its distinctive flavor.

Key Ingredients in Mee Siam Paste:
Dried shrimp: Adds a savory umami depth.
Shallots and garlic: Essential for a rich base taste.
Chili paste: Provides the warmth and spice to the dish.
Tamarind paste: Provides a tangy, bitter Take note that balances the sweetness.
Lemongrass: Infuses a fragrant citrus aroma.
Fermented bean paste: Boosts the complexity which has a salty, fermented taste.
The paste is often combined that has a broth comprised of tamarind juice and shrimp inventory, which happens to be then poured around slender rice vermicelli noodles. The dish is garnished with tricky-boiled eggs, tau pok (fried tofu puffs), and in some cases prawns or hen, making a hearty, flavorful meal.

two. Ayam Buah Keluak: A Peranakan Culinary Masterpiece
For A very exceptional Peranakan dining expertise, Ayam Buah Keluak is a must-try dish. It’s a loaded, earthy rooster stew which is slow-cooked with the enigmatic buah keluak nut, a vital component that gives the dish its dim colour and complex, a little bit bitter style.

What exactly is Buah Keluak?
Buah keluak will be the seed of your Pangium edule tree, indigenous to Southeast Asia. The seeds are poisonous inside their raw sort and have to undergo a fermentation course of action just before they are Safe and sound to consume. At the time well prepared, the flesh In the nut is scraped out, mashed, and often combined with spices prior to staying stuffed back in the nut.

Key Characteristics of Ayam Buah Keluak:
Taste: The dish is characterized by its deep, savory flavor with hints of bitterness within the buah keluak. The chicken absorbs the prosperous flavors of your stew, which can be Improved with spices like galangal, lemongrass, and turmeric.
Preparing: The dish is labor-intensive, since the buah keluak nuts need to be cautiously well prepared. This is often what tends to make Ayam Buah Keluak a prized dish in Peranakan cuisine.
Texture: The chicken turns into tender from sluggish cooking, when the buah keluak paste provides a novel, creamy texture to the stew.
Ayam Buah Keluak is actually a dish that showcases the intricate cooking tactics of Peranakan Delicacies, Mixing earthy, bitter, and spicy flavors right into a comforting stew.

3. Mee Siam: A Tangy and Spicy Noodle Delight
When Mee Siam paste is an important ingredient, the whole dish is usually a pleasant mix of flavors and textures. Mee Siam, which implies “Siamese noodles,” is considered to obtain Thai influences but has been adapted right into a quintessential Nyonya dish.

Factors of Mee Siam:
Rice vermicelli noodles: These slim noodles take in the flavorful broth, building them the proper foundation to the dish.
Broth: The broth would be the star of Mee Siam, a harmonious combination of sour tamarind, spicy chili, and sweet palm sugar. The combination of shrimp inventory and tamarind offers the dish its exclusive sweet and tangy flavor profile.
Toppings: Mee Siam is typically garnished with tricky-boiled eggs, tau pok, prawns, or rooster. Some versions also contain beansprouts and chives.

4. The ideal Nyonya Foods in Singapore
Singapore is home to many of the very best Nyonya food on the earth, with a number of places to eat supplying reliable Peranakan Delicacies. Here are a few dishes that happen to be must-tries for any person Checking out Peranakan meals in Singapore:

A. Laksa
A abundant, spicy coconut-based noodle soup, Laksa is actually a fusion of Chinese and Malay flavors, normally topped with shrimp, fish cakes, and difficult-boiled eggs. The creamy coconut milk broth and spicy sambal develop a comforting and indulgent dish.

B. Nyonya Chap Chye
A vegetable stew built with cabbage, mushrooms, and dried shrimp, cooked inside a fermented soybean sauce. It’s a flavorful and nutritious dish typically served to be a side in the course of festive meals.

C. Ngoh Hiang
A style of 5-spice meat roll, Ngoh Hiang is made from minced pork, shrimp, and water chestnuts, wrapped in beancurd skin and fried to crispy perfection. It’s a well known appetizer in Peranakan cuisine.

D. Kueh Pie Tee
Kueh Pie Tee can be a crunchy pastry cup stuffed with a combination of stewed turnips, carrots, shrimp, and in some cases pork. It’s a lightweight, Chunk-sized snack that’s jam packed with taste.
